public bool DeletePhieuChi(DTO.PhieuChi pc) { string query = string.Empty; query += "DELETE FROM PHIEUCHI WHERE [MAPHIEUCHI] = @maPhieuChi"; using (SqlConnection con = dc.GetConnect()) { using (SqlCommand cmd = new SqlCommand()) { cmd.Connection = con; cmd.CommandType = System.Data.CommandType.Text; cmd.CommandText = query; cmd.Parameters.AddWithValue("@maPhieuChi", pc.mapc); try { con.Open(); cmd.ExecuteNonQuery(); con.Close(); con.Dispose(); } catch (Exception ex) { con.Close(); return(false); } } } return(true); }
public bool InsertPhieuChi(DTO.PhieuChi pc) { string sql = "INSERT INTO PHIEUCHI(MAPHIEUCHI, id_Nhan_Vien,TENPC,SOTIEN,NOIDUNG,THOIGIAN) VALUES(@MAPCHI, @ID,@TEN,@TIEN,@ND,@TIME)"; SqlConnection con = dc.GetConnect(); try { cmd = new SqlCommand(sql, con); con.Open(); cmd.Parameters.Add("@MAPCHI", SqlDbType.VarChar).Value = TaoMaPhieuChi(); cmd.Parameters.Add("@ID", SqlDbType.NVarChar).Value = pc.manv; cmd.Parameters.Add("@TEN", SqlDbType.NVarChar).Value = pc.tenpc; cmd.Parameters.Add("@TIEN", SqlDbType.Decimal).Value = pc.giapc; cmd.Parameters.Add("@ND", SqlDbType.NVarChar).Value = pc.noidung; cmd.Parameters.Add("@TIME", SqlDbType.DateTime).Value = pc.thoigian; cmd.ExecuteNonQuery(); con.Close(); } catch (Exception e) { return(false); } return(true); }
public bool DeletePhieuChi(DTO.PhieuChi pc) { return(dalPC.DeletePhieuChi(pc)); }
public bool InsertPhieuChi(DTO.PhieuChi pc) { return(dalPC.InsertPhieuChi(pc)); }